Output 61b8530ec5c5eb9a2f1aed64b67cf0fa76d9c85cdce967d85bb550b46f4e7916:0
- value
- 17650027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d64fd7760246176445f95c50314cc62f7721aa92 OP_EQUAL
- address
- 3MECB6BbLZhoSjyfMncsFcWuxy9nj1Z33b
- transaction
- 61b8530ec5c5eb9a2f1aed64b67cf0fa76d9c85cdce967d85bb550b46f4e7916
- spent
- true